With the help of the newly released SUV Urus, Lamborghini's sales in 20 19 have achieved explosive growth, and the performance of 8205 vehicles has increased by 43% over the previous year. This is the ninth consecutive year that they have achieved global sales growth and set a new record in every market. Although Urus has contributed nearly 5,000 vehicles, the super-running performance with V 10 and V 12 is also very gratifying. This generation of "Mavericks", namely Huracan, has only a history of more than five years in 20 19, but it has become the best-selling model in Lamborghini history with the cumulative sales of14,000 vehicles-its predecessor Gallardo took twice as long to obtain the same data.
The factory of Saint Agatha (1963) occupied about 1000 square meters when it was just built, and has now been expanded to 16000 square meters. The number of employees has also increased significantly: 20 1 1, less than 1000, and now there are about 1800, of which 700 people have been recruited in the past two years, and most of them are on the production line of Urus.
At the beginning of Urus production, the car body was delivered after being painted in Audi's factory in Kassoum, but now there is a special SUV painting workshop in Santagata. This makes it easier to perform advanced personalization in the production process. About 70% of Aventador's orders and nearly half of Huracan's orders are customized to varying degrees, and more and more Urus customers want their cars to have a unique appearance.
Countach #00 1: Double Unique
This Countach 1973 was made by a team of 10 people, and the chassis number was 00 1. It is the oldest existing Countach- the first prototype of pre-production engineering, which was killed in a collision test in the early 1970s.
Despite its special historical position, it was sold once because the company was short of funds. When it was used as an exhibition car, it was replaced with a strange inner room, but the recent restoration made it as old as ever.
Both of them are "big cows" of V 12, but Countach is very different from its predecessor, Mihura. The engine is twisted 90 degrees to become vertical, and the chassis is changed from semi-single structure to space frame design.
Valentino Balboni, a retired legendary Lamborghini test engineer, admitted: "The early model did have many problems. The chassis is too complicated, consisting of too many pieces of metal of different sizes, and there are welds everywhere. The structural strength is not high enough. " Balboni prefers the later Countach S.
But the antique car market disagrees with him. The highest transaction price of an early model similar to this one reached 6,543,800+0,000 at auction, which doubled its value. How's this? Priceless, not for sale.

But what really sets Sian apart is the technology it uses. Like almost all carmakers, Lamborghini knows that hybrid power is the key to the medium-term future because it has advantages in reducing carbon emissions.
It's not fair! Any car parked next to Mihura will look bland.
"The biggest problem we have to solve has always been how to integrate this technology without adding hundreds of kilograms of unnecessary weight." Reggiani said. This veteran who has worked in Santagata for 22 years has a proud resume, one of which is the Bugatti EB 1 10 in the 1990s.
Sian's solution is to equip Aventador's V 12 engine with supercapacitors. This is a very advanced battery technology with amazing charging and discharging speed, which was previewed on Terzo Millennio. The capacitor is a 30 mm deep rectangular box on the rear bulkhead of the cab, which drives the 7-speed transmission. Its output power is not big, only 34 horsepower, but because it doesn't need a cooling system, it won't bring any weight trouble. Capacitors and motors only increased the weight by 34kg, but Lamborghini engineers reduced the weight by "slimming" the chassis and body14kg.
Reggiani said: "The output power of supercapacitors is twice that of lithium-ion batteries with the same weight, and it will never decay!" (The number of charge and discharge cycles of supercapacitors is much higher than that of ordinary batteries. )
In Corsa mode, the capacitor provides extra power for acceleration, which can be maintained to 132km/h, and then the motor will be disconnected to prevent overspeed. However, in Strada (street) mode, when the vehicle is driving on the city road, the electric power will fill the torque gap of the traditional single clutch paddle shift automatic transmission.
"When driving and stopping at a low speed, all actions are controlled by electricity," Reggiani said excitedly. "There will be no setbacks, it is very smooth, comfortable and easy to control."
But Xi 'an will not be quiet for a moment. The engine needs to run all the time, otherwise the hydraulic power steering system will lose power. Similarly, Sian has no pure electric mode. In the case of other manufacturers switching to electricity, more delicate and direct hydraulic power feedback has become a highlight of Lamborghini models, and it will accompany us at least in the next five or six years, that is, before the whole line of products is replaced.
Sean's comprehensive output of oil and electricity is 8 19 horsepower, so it has become the most powerful model of Lamborghini highway. The acceleration performance is also the strongest, with 0 to 100 km/h less than 2.8 seconds required by Aventador SVJ, and 70 to 120 km/h is faster than SVJ by 1.2 seconds.
However, in the absence of a test drive, is Sean (unlisted in China and priced at about 26.4 million RMB overseas) with a price/performance ratio of more than 3 million euros not high enough? After all, the price of Ferrari SF90, which is also a hybrid model, is only about one sixth of that (3.988 million yuan in China), and the comprehensive maximum power reaches 65,438+0,000 horsepower. Domenicali said that its cost performance is very high, because it will maintain a high value-it is unlikely to depreciate, and it may even help car owners make money, which is of course the key factor to measure the cost performance.
The reason for maintaining high value is that Sian is a limited-edition car, which will only produce 63 cars-commemorating Lamborghini's founding in1963-and SF90 is a series of production cars. Scarcity alone is enough to get rich people to take out checkbooks.
In addition, a few selected car owners can buy more special and personalized models at relatively little extra cost.
Domenicali said, "We have another project. We produce two cars for very special customers every year, and the price is about 4 million to 5 million dollars (28.6 million to 35.7 million RMB). Their prototype is Aventador, but the shape is completely different. They don't use hybrid power-this project focuses more on styling than technology. Customers will come to us with their own ideas, and we will help them become a reality. We plan to start delivery from 202 1. These two cars are completely different in appearance, but you can tell at a glance that they are Lamborghini. This is very important. "
